Output 1320db68bca1829684b0e65216c92d2e0f05e95ff2d9c8b55d4b2447261f646a:40

value
9355287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cb6e72fef95df33b2413f96c3a345aa0aff44e9 OP_EQUAL
address
3QjFKDLPNzovk3NKCK5qTrhVjAQ1S7PFEu
transaction
1320db68bca1829684b0e65216c92d2e0f05e95ff2d9c8b55d4b2447261f646a
spent
true